源码网址

开源软件与Linux内核资源
### Android 源码相关仓库地址和镜像站点 Android 源代码托管在 Google 的 Git 仓库中,官方主仓库地址为 `https://android.googlesource.com/platform/manifest`,该仓库包含了 Android 源码的元数据信息,包括源码变更记录和时间戳等[^1]。为了加快源码下载速度,许多国内高校和机构提供了镜像服务。 #### 官方仓库地址 - **Google 官方仓库地址**: ```bash https://android.googlesource.com/platform/manifest ``` #### 国内镜像站点 以下是一些常用的国内镜像地址,可用于替代官方仓库以提升下载速度: - **清华大学镜像地址**: ```bash https://mirrors.tuna.tsinghua.edu.cn/git/AOSP/platform/manifest ``` 清华大学提供的镜像支持多种 Android 版本的源码下载,并可通过指定分支名获取特定版本的源码 [^1]。 - **中科大镜像地址**: ```bash https://aosp.mirror.ustc.edu.cn/platform/manifest ``` 中国科学技术大学也维护了完整的 Android 源码镜像,适合国内开发者使用。 - **华为云镜像地址**: ```bash https://mirrors.huaweicloud.com/repository/git ``` 华为云提供的开源镜像站也支持 AOSP 源码下载。 #### 使用 Repo 工具初始化仓库 在使用上述镜像地址时,可以通过 `repo init` 命令来初始化本地仓库,并指定所需的分支。例如,使用清华大学镜像并指定 `android-15.0.0_r2` 分支: ```bash repo init -u https://mirrors.tuna.tsinghua.edu.cn/git/AOSP/platform/manifest -b android-15.0.0_r2 ``` 该命令会初始化一个本地仓库,并将远程仓库地址设置为清华大学镜像地址,同时切换到指定分支 [^1]。 #### 其他注意事项 在进行源码同步时,建议使用 `repo sync` 命令并结合 `-j` 参数以启用多线程下载,提高效率: ```bash repo sync -j4 ``` 如果遇到同步失败的情况,可以尝试清理 `.repo` 目录下的子模块或重新初始化仓库 [^4]。 ---
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值